✨ qr login page /reset password page
This commit is contained in:
25
src/views/Login/LoginFooter.vue
Normal file
25
src/views/Login/LoginFooter.vue
Normal file
@@ -0,0 +1,25 @@
|
||||
<template>
|
||||
<div>
|
||||
<ADivider/>
|
||||
<AFlex :vertical="false" align="center" justify="space-around">
|
||||
<AButton @click="()=>{
|
||||
router.push('/qrlogin')
|
||||
}" class="login-form-bottom-button" :icon="h(QrcodeOutlined)">{{ t("login.qrLogin") }}
|
||||
</AButton>
|
||||
<AButton class="login-form-bottom-button" :icon="h(QqOutlined)"></AButton>
|
||||
<AButton class="login-form-bottom-button" :icon="h(GithubOutlined)"></AButton>
|
||||
</AFlex>
|
||||
</div>
|
||||
</template>
|
||||
<script setup lang="ts">
|
||||
import {GithubOutlined, QqOutlined, QrcodeOutlined} from "@ant-design/icons-vue";
|
||||
import {useI18n} from "vue-i18n";
|
||||
import {h} from "vue";
|
||||
import {useRouter} from 'vue-router'
|
||||
|
||||
const router = useRouter();
|
||||
const {t} = useI18n();
|
||||
</script>
|
||||
<style src="./index.scss" scoped>
|
||||
|
||||
</style>
|
Reference in New Issue
Block a user